What is a remote Amazon private label?

A Remote Amazon Private Label job involves creating and selling products under your own brand on Amazon, while working from anywhere. Professionals in this role research profitable products, find manufacturers (often overseas), manage product listings, and handle marketing and logistics—all remotely. The goal is to build a successful brand that stands out from generic listings on Amazon's marketplace. This job usually requires skills in product research, e-commerce, digital marketing, and supply chain management.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ote Amazon private label specialist?

To thrive as a Remote Amazon Private Label Specialist, you need expertise in product research, supply chain management, and e-commerce operations, often supported by experience in Amazon Seller Central. Familiarity with tools like Helium 10, Jungle Scout, and inventory management systems, as well as knowledge of FBA processes, is typically required. Strong analytical thinking, negotiation skills, and effective communication set top performers apart in this role. These skills and qualities are crucial for identifying profitable products, managing supplier relationships, and driving sustained growth in a competitive online marketplace.

What are some common challenges faced by remote Amazon private label specialists, and how can they be addressed?

Remote Amazon Private Label specialists often encounter challenges such as managing supplier relationships across different time zones, staying compliant with Amazon’s policies, and keeping up with competitive market trends. To address these, effective communication tools, regular supplier check-ins, and using project management platforms can help streamline collaboration. Staying informed through Amazon’s seller updates and utilizing analytics tools to monitor competitors are also essential. Building a network with other private label sellers can provide valuable insights and support for overcoming obstacles.

What is the difference between Remote Amazon Private Label vs Remote Amazon Product Listing Specialist?

AspectRemote Amazon Private LabelRemote Amazon Product Listing Specialist
CredentialsKnowledge of Amazon FBA, branding, product researchExperience with Amazon listing optimization, keywords, product descriptions
Work EnvironmentSelf-managed, entrepreneurial, product development focusCollaborative, detail-oriented, listing management
Employer & IndustryPrivate label brands, e-commerce entrepreneursAmazon sellers, e-commerce companies
Search & Comparison IntentStarting or managing private label brands on AmazonOptimizing product listings for better visibility and sales

Remote Amazon Private Label roles involve creating and managing private label brands, focusing on product development and branding. In contrast, Remote Amazon Product Listing Specialists focus on optimizing existing product listings to improve search rankings and sales. Both roles require Amazon platform knowledge but differ in scope and responsibilities.
